How long do I need to bake my curry chicken


The length of time that you need to bake curry chicken depends on what you are trying to achieve. If you want tender chicken meat, then 45 minutes at 375 F. is perfect amount of time in my opinion. That way your chicken is not only fully cooked, it is also fall of the bone tender – so tender as a matter of fact, that you will want to eat it all in one seating! Brace yourselves!


What if I don’t have chicken drumsticks


If you don’t have chicken drumsticks, this recipe works well with chicken thighs. Or even chicken breasts! What I personally found is that chicken drumsticks are tender and juicy when cooked in this flavorful curry sauce, that’s why they are my go to option for curry chicken.


This recipe makes enough for 1 and 1/2 pounds of drumsticks, which is 6 drumsticks. All of them fit into my 12 inch Lodge skillet, which by the way is the most useful skillet in my kitchen. However, if you happened to buy a large amount of drumsticks and want to go big, simply double the amount of spices to make as much curried chicken as you like!

Baked Curry Chicken



These Baked Curry Chicken Drumsticks only require a few spices to really make them stand out. They are juicy, tender, and full of flavor. 


Course Main Course
Cuisine Indian
Keyword curry chicken


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 45 minutes
Total Time 55 minutes


Servings 6


Author Olya



Ingredients

  • 3 tablespoons plain yogurt
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 teaspoons cumin powder
  • 1 teaspoon ground ginger
  • 1/4 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per
  • 1/4 teaspoon sea salt
  • 3 cloves garlic chopped
  • 1.5 lb. chicken drumsticks or thighs
  • 1/4 cup chicken broth

Instructions

  • Add yogurt, olive oil, cumin powder, ginger, cinnamon, cayenne pepper, salt, and garlic to a large mixing bowl and stir to combine.
  • Add the chicken and mix to coat it well.
  • Brown chicken drumsticks in the pan for about 6-8 minutes in an oven safe skillet (such as cast iron pan). Deglaze the bottom of the pan with chicken broth.
  • Bake at 375 degrees Fahrenheit for 45 minutes.
  • Remove from the oven and let sit for 10 minutes before serving.
